WEBBasic Oxygen Furnace (BOF) steel making or Basic Oxygen Furnace Steelmaking (BOS) or LinzDonawitzVerfahren steelmaking or the oxygen converter process is a method in which both molten pig iron and steel scrap are converted into steel with the oxidizing action of oxygen blown into the melt under a basic slag.

WEBMar 16, 2013 · Iron ore is used mostly in pellet and/or lumpy form. Oxygen (O2) is removed from the iron ore by chemical reactions based on H2 and CO for the production of highly metalized DRI. In the direct reduction process, the solid metallic iron (Fe) is obtained directly from solid iron ore without subjecting the ore or the metal to fusion.

WEBMar 8, 2021 · BFBOF route employs a blast furnace (BF) to reduce the iron ore to molten iron and subsequently refined to steel in a basic oxygen furnace (BOF). As the dominant technology for primary steelmaking, BFBOF route produced 71% of global crude steel production, over 1279 million tons in 2018 [(Worldsteel Association, 2019]].

WEBIn the late 1850s Henry Bessemer invented a new steelmaking process which involved blowing air through molten pigiron to burn off carbon, and so producing mild steel. This and other 19thcentury and later steelmaking processes have displaced wrought iron. Today, wrought iron is no longer produced on a commercial scale, having been .
